Finding the perfect Kiribaku fanfic can feel like digging for gold, but once you strike it rich, the payoff is incredible. My go-to spots are Archive of Our Own (AO3) and FanFiction.net, where the tags and filters make it easy to sort by kudos or comments to find the most beloved stories. AO3 especially has a vibrant community with detailed tags—look for 'slow burn' or 'angst with a happy ending' if that's your jam.
I stumbled on this one fic titled 'Explosive Chemistry' last year, and wow, it ruined me for weeks. The author nailed Bakugo's gruff exterior hiding deep emotions and Kirishima's unwavering support. Pro tip: check out curated collections or rec lists on Tumblr; some hardcore fans compile masterposts of the best-rated fics. Also, don’t skip the comment sections—sometimes readers drop gems like 'if you liked this, try [X] by the same author.'

Finding great BakuKiri content with a bit of spice is a whole mood. Honestly, I almost always start on Archive of Our Own—their tagging system is a lifesaver. You can filter by the pairing, then add tags like 'Explicit' or 'Mature' and maybe 'Smut' if that's the specific vibe you're after. Sorting by kudos or bookmarks usually surfaces the really popular, well-written stuff. I've stumbled on some absolute masterpieces that way, where the dynamic is just perfect—all that aggressive pining and intense loyalty translated into something genuinely hot.
Don't sleep on Tumblr either, though it's more of a deep dive. A lot of writers will post snippets or moodboards there and then link to their full works on AO3. Searching tags like '#bkdk' (though careful, that's mostly Deku) or '#kiribaku' can lead you to dedicated blogs that recc fics. Twitter's a bit harder to navigate for full stories, but following artists or writers who specialize in the ship often means they'll retweet or signal-boost spicy fics from others. It's more about building a curated feed over time.
My one slightly contrarian take? Sometimes the best 'spicy' fics aren't the ones tagged most explicitly. I've read some 'Mature'-rated ones that were all slow-burn tension and charged moments that hit way harder than some outright Explicit ones. The emotional build-up matters so much for this pairing. So maybe broaden your search a little beyond just the 'E' rating, you might be surprised.
